Closed Bug 667890 Opened 14 years ago Closed 14 years ago

Any localized edits made between two ready-for-l10n English revisions are removed

Categories

(support.mozilla.org :: Knowledge Base Software, task, P1)

task

Tracking

(Not tracked)

VERIFIED FIXED
2011-07-19

People

(Reporter: scoobidiver, Assigned: rrosario)

Details

A localized revision is associated to an English revision. If there are edits based on the localized revision, they are removed when there is a new ready-for-l10n English revision. See: https://support.mozilla.com/fr/kb/Les%20modules%20compl%C3%A9mentaires%20sont%20d%C3%A9sactiv%C3%A9s%20apr%C3%A8s%20une%20mise%20%C3%A0%20jour%20de%20Firefox/history https://support.mozilla.com/fr/kb/Les%20modules%20compl%C3%A9mentaires%20sont%20d%C3%A9sactiv%C3%A9s%20apr%C3%A8s%20une%20mise%20%C3%A0%20jour%20de%20Firefox/revision/15143 : The keywords added in this revision were removed when I tried to translate the new ready-for-l10n English revision.
To clarify the above example: * French revision 12157 has been based on French revision 11755 (right editor) and English revision 11844 (left editor). * French revision 15318 has been based on French revision 12157 (right editor)(instead of 15143) and English revision 15291 (left editor). As long as this bug is not fixed, any ready-for-localization article approvals should be postponed.
So, what do you mean with "If there are edits based on the localized revision". Do you mean edits *to* the localized revision?
(In reply to comment #2) > Do you mean edits *to* the localized revision? Yes.
This is serious, and it looks like Bug 668609 is related indeed. James, can you make this a priority for 7-19? We are going to ready for l10n Firefox 6 articles in two weeks from now, and this would cause a lot of confusion.
Target Milestone: --- → 2011-07-19
This may be fixed with the patch for Bug 668609. I will investigate.
Assignee: nobody → rrosario
Priority: -- → P1
This looks fixed to me. I just did the following on stage and it worked as expected. 1- Create new document (https://support.allizom.org/en-US/kb/test-doc), approve and mark as ready for l10n. 2- Translate to Spanish (https://support.allizom.org/es/kb/doc-prueba) and approve. 3- Create new English revision and approve w/o marking as ready for l10n. 4- Create new Spanish revision (translate page correctly shows the original english revision which was ready for l10n) and approve. 5- Create new English revision and approve as ready for l10n. 6- Go to create new Spanish revision. Verify that it is based on the revision from step 4 and that it shows the English revision from step 5.
Status: NEW → RESOLVED
Closed: 14 years ago
Resolution: --- → FIXED
BTW, can comment 6 become a selenium test?
Verified that approved locale revision displays in addition to approved en-US changes. Marked this as eligible for automation.
Status: RESOLVED → VERIFIED
Flags: in-testsuite?
You need to log in before you can comment on or make changes to this bug.